As verbs the difference between enlisted and registered
is that enlisted is past tense of enlist while registered is past tense of register.As adjectives the difference between enlisted and registered
is that enlisted is belonging to the military, but not as a commissioned officer while registered is having had one's name added to an official list or entered into a register.As a noun enlisted
is those individuals who have enlisted in the military and who are not commissioned officers.enlisted
